Toronto to Massachusetts is a very active Northeast logistics lane driven heavily by education, healthcare and the biotech sector. Clients on this corridor tend to be medical professionals and researchers heading to the world-class hospitals and pharma hubs in Boston and Cambridge, academics heading to universities like Harvard and MIT, and families heading to sprawling suburbs like Newton, Brookline or out west toward Worcester and Springfield.

Shipments range from consolidated loads to brownstone apartments in historic Boston neighborhoods, to full household moves into large single family homes throughout the Commonwealth. How Much Does it Cost to Move from Toronto to Massachusetts?

Type of Move Estimated Cost
Small Move $569 to $1,229
1 Bedroom Apartment $1,229 to $2,659
2 Bedroom Apartment $2,659 to $4,599
3 Bedroom House $4,709 to $6,139
Office Relocation $1,539 to $9,199

Inventory Volume (Cubic Feet) + Distance/Route + Destination Logistics

Certificate of Insurance (COI), elevator reservations or use of smaller shuttle trucks due to limited truck access. There may be additional handling charges for these. In older, historic Boston neighborhoods like Beacon Hill and the North End, the narrow, centuries-old streets often require commercial parking permits and smaller shuttle vehicles for deliveries.

Truck Route from Toronto to Massachusetts

For moves to Massachusetts, our commercial trucks usually cross through the Buffalo-Niagara Falls commercial crossing to facilitate a quick and efficient clearing of U.S. Customs. The logistics route once in New York State is surprisingly simple, almost entirely following the I-90 East corridor. It goes through Upstate New York (on the New York State Thruway), then into Massachusetts and continues on I-90 East, also known as the Massachusetts Turnpike. This major transcontinental interstate is the main artery across the state, passing through Springfield and Worcester before dropping right into the heart of the Boston metropolitan area.

If you are moving from Toronto to Boston you need to have:


1. Passport, 2. Visa or Green Card (if you are not a US resident), 3. The completed customs form 3299.
